Start an Inspection from a Schedule
Execute a scheduled inspection that was assigned to you by a manager or supervisor.
Before You Start
- You need access to the Inspections module
- An inspection must be scheduled and assigned to you or your team
- You will receive a notification when a new inspection is scheduled for you
Steps
Step 1: Access scheduled inspections
- Click Inspections in the left navigation bar
- Switch to the Scheduled view to see your upcoming inspections

Step 2: Find your scheduled inspection
In the scheduled view, you see inspections assigned to you with:
- Template name
- Description
- Inspection ID
- Scheduled date and time
- Inspection questions
Use the search bar to find a specific inspection if you have multiple scheduled.

Step 3: Start the inspection
- Click on the scheduled inspection you want to execute
- The inspection opens with the template already selected
- You see the inspection details: name, description, sections, pages, and questions

Step 4: Complete the inspection
- Answer each question in the inspection
- Upload evidence when required or prompted
- Add comments to provide additional context
- Create corrective actions if you identify issues
Your progress is tracked as a percentage so you know how much remains.
Step 5: Review and finalize
- After answering all questions, click Continue
- Review the summary showing all your answers
- Edit any responses if needed
- Click Finalize to complete the inspection
The completed inspection is saved with full traceability and available for supervisor review.
Scheduled vs. Ad-Hoc Inspections
| Aspect | Scheduled Inspection | Ad-Hoc Inspection |
|---|---|---|
| Who creates it | Manager/Supervisor schedules in advance | Operator starts on demand |
| Template selection | Pre-assigned based on schedule | Operator chooses from available templates |
| Due date | Set by scheduler | None (or set by operator if supported) |
| Visibility | Appears in Scheduled view | Created directly via Execute Inspection |
Tips
- Check your scheduled inspections at the start of each shift to plan your work
- Complete inspections before their due date to maintain compliance
- If you cannot complete a scheduled inspection, inform your supervisor so it can be reassigned
- Scheduled inspections may recur (daily, weekly, monthly) — completing one generates the next occurrence automatically
